Types of Car Insurance Policies

There are several types of car insurance policies available, each catering to different needs and circumstances. Liability coverage is the most basic type and is often required by law; it covers damages to other vehicles and medical expenses arising from an accident where you are at fault. Collision coverage pays for damages to your own vehicle, regardless of who is at fault, while comprehensive coverage protects against non-collision-related incidents, such as theft or natural disasters. Understanding the distinctions between these policies is crucial, as selecting the right combination of coverage can provide significant financial protection and peace of mind when you’re on the road. Factors Influencing Premiums

Numerous factors influence the premiums you pay for car insurance, including your driving history, the type of vehicle you own, and your geographic location. Insurers assess your risk profile based on your past behavior behind the wheel; a clean driving record can lower your rates, while frequent claims can increase them. Additionally, the make and model of your car can significantly affect premiums, as some vehicles are more prone to accidents or theft. Understanding these factors allows drivers to make strategic choices, such as opting for safety features that can lower costs and maintaining a clean driving record to ensure more favorable pricing.
